Metlifecare  (ASX:MEQ) Pretax Margin % Explanation

The pretax margin, as know as pretax profit margin, is widely used to measure the operating efficiency of a company before deducting taxes.

The pretax margin is sometimes preferred over the net margin as tax expenditures can make profitability comparisons between companies misleading.

It is a useful tool to compare companies operating in the same sector and less effective when comparing companies from other sectors as each industry generally has different operating expenses and sales patterns.

The long term trend of the pretax margin is a good indicator of the competitiveness and health of the business.

Metlifecare Pretax Margin % Calculation

Pretax margin - also known as pretax profit margin is the ratio of Pretax Income divided by net sales or Revenue, usually presented in percent.

Metlifecare's Pretax Margin for the fiscal year that ended in Jun. 2020 is calculated as

Pretax Margin=Pre-Tax Income (A: Jun. 2020 )/Revenue (A: Jun. 2020 )
=-56.561/125.193
=-45.18 %

Metlifecare's Pretax Margin for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2020 is calculated as

Pretax Margin=Pre-Tax Income (Q: Jun. 2020 )/Revenue (Q: Jun. 2020 )
=-83.794/64.196
=-130.53 %

Metlifecare Business Description

Address 20 Kent Street, Level 4, Newmarket, Auckland, NTL, NZL, 1023
Metlifecare Ltd operates retirement communities throughout New Zealand. It generates revenue from membership fees and rest home, hospital and service, and village fees. Metlifecare's membership fees are paid by residents of independent living units and serviced apartments and allow residents to use common facilities. Its largest single customer is the New Zealand government, which pays fees on behalf of residents eligible for government subsidized elderly care. The majority of Metlifecare's retirement villages are located in Auckland.
